One last question - any tips for leading a productive brainstorming session at that upcoming team meeting to get everyone engaged and thinking creatively?" }, { "from": "gpt", "value": "Absolutely! Here are a few tips for leading an engaging and creative team brainstorming session:\n\n1. Set the stage: Prior to the meeting, send out a brief agenda and encourage everyone to come prepared with ideas. This primes people to start thinking creatively ahead of time.\n\n2. Create the right environment: Aim to create an open, non-judgmental atmosphere where all ideas are welcome. Make it clear that there are no bad ideas in brainstorming.\n\n3. Vary the brainstorming techniques: Use a mix of structured brainstorming activities (like brainwriting, rapid ideation, \"how might we\" prompts) and unstructured discussion time. This engages different thinking styles.\n\n4. Build and combine ideas: Encourage people to build upon each other's ideas. One way to do this is through \"yes, and\" thinking - affirming an idea, then adding to it. This creates collaborative energy.\n\n5. Capture all the ideas: Have a designated scribe to write down all the ideas that emerge (on a whiteboard, sticky notes, virtual collaboration doc, etc). This validates contributions and serves as a record.\n\n6. Prioritize and decide next steps: Wrap up by identifying common themes, prioritizing the most promising ideas, and defining clear next steps and owners to move things forward. This helps turn ideas into action.\n\nMost importantly, bring your own curiosity and enthusiasm to the process! If you model creative and collaborative energy, the team is likely to match it. Brainstorming can and should be fun, so be sure to incorporate some lightheartedness along the way.\n\nHope this sparks some ideas for your brainstorming session! Let me know how it goes." } ]

I want to make sure my emails are always clear and professional." }, { "from": "gpt", "value": "Absolutely, I'm happy to share some general email writing tips! Here are a few key things to keep in mind:\n\n1. Keep it concise and to the point. Busy professionals appreciate emails that are clear and brief. Stick to the essential information and avoid lengthy, meandering sentences or paragraphs.\n\n2. Use a professional tone that is friendly but not overly casual. Avoid slang, jokes, or informal language that could be misinterpreted. However, do try to strike a warm, approachable tone.\n\n3. Proofread carefully for spelling, grammar, and clarity. Emails with typos or confusing wording look sloppy and unprofessional. Always give your message a final read-through before hitting send.\n\n4. Utilize clear subject lines that summarize the purpose of your email. This helps the recipient quickly determine the importance and relevance of your message.\n\n5. Structure your email logically with an appropriate greeting, a clear purpose statement, supporting information broken up into short paragraphs, and a polite closing and signature.\n\n6. When requesting something or asking questions, be specific about what you need and when you need it by. Make it as easy as possible for the recipient to understand and respond to your request.\n\n7. If you're emailing about something emotionally charged or sensitive, consider waiting and re-reading your draft later when you're calm. Emotional emails sent in haste are rarely productive.\n\nI hope these tips are useful for you! With practice and attention to detail, strong email writing will become second nature.
